Detective Pikachu Movie in the Works for 2017
It looks like Hollywood is ready to try and exploit the huge wave of momentum that Pokemon Go is riding at the moment. It looks like it’s coming in the form of a live-action movie based on the Pokemon franchise for Detective Pikachu. Variety reports that Legendary Entertainment is producing the first Pokemon movie in a partnership with The Pokemon Company to launch a live-action film franchise. The first film in this franchise is set to be Detective Pikachu.
According to the report, the first film is being fast-tracked for a 2017 release. Whether it will actually make that time frame remains to be seen. After the massive success of Pokemon Go after it’s huge launch, Hollywood had apparently renewed its interests in turning the franchise into a feature film. Another video game-turned-film adaptation that Legendary worked on was Warcraft, which didn’t do very well at the US box office, but it did perform better overseas.
The Great Detective Pikachu game featured Pikachu in the role of a detective. This version of Pikachu is also capable of speech. However, the game has not yet even been released in the US.
